    New Norcia

    September 2, 2017 in Australia ⋅ ⛅ 28 °C

    What a hidden gem! The only monastic town in Australia. Founded by Spanish monks in 1847 as a mission for local aboriginals, the town has two old boarding schools, flour mill, Abbey Church, wine press, grand hotel and a monastery.

    We took a 2 hour walking tour around the town, which was great as we learned the incredible history of the place. We even went to mass on Sunday morning mainly so we could hear the beautiful pipe organ and visiting choir.
